A curated list of Wayland resources
-
Updated
Jul 16, 2025
Wayland is a communication protocol that specifies the communication between a display server and its clients.
A curated list of Wayland resources
Sources for https://arewewaylandyet.com
experimental Wayland Vulkan compositor
The missing Wayland protocols for features that are available in X11 (but are denied by the official Wayland protocols)
XR Windowing System on top of Wayland
Haskell implementation of the wayland protocol
Simple Screen Locker for Wayland based Compositors
Wayland Guide
💭 1s2 ○ A noble, light and aesthetic bar for Wayland // wlroots. [Wip]
This Python tool automates mouse and keyboard actions on Wayland environments, allowing clicks, swipes, and text input. It uses virtual devices to simulate interactions, filling the gap where other automation tools fall short for Wayland. It's a unique solution for Wayland-specific automation.
Ada 2012 bindings for Wayland
A Qt-based wayland compositor + Multiple displays support + Several test applications (GStreamer's glimagesink plugin used to render under Qml, EGL+Wayland implementation)
libglace; library for managing and getting info about wayland clients
🖌️ (ALPHA) A simple color picker for Wayland.
Wayland bindings for Odin
Created by Kristian Høgsberg
Released September 30, 2008